Top 5 Best Monroe County Public Schools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 5 public schools serving 1,153 students in Monroe County, IA.
The top ranked public schools in Monroe County, IA are Albia Middle School, Albia High School and Lincoln Center.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Monroe County, IA public schools have an average math proficiency score of 68% (versus the Iowa public school average of 64%), and reading proficiency score of 77% (versus the 68% statewide average). Schools in Monroe County have an average ranking of 8/10, which is in the top 30% of Iowa public schools.
Minority enrollment is 9%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Iowa public school average of 27% (majority Hispanic).
